I heard someone say they thought the ZSA would be an upgrade over the ZS6. It doesn't seem like an upgrade.

Anyone one else get this feeling the ZSA will not be around as long as the ES4 since the ES4 was a planned/teased release?

I would take the "upgrade over the ZS6" claim with a pinch of salt....correction, pound of salt. I doubt that the single DD used in the ZSA will be as adept at separating sub-bass and mid-bass frequencies as the ZS6's two separate DD's separate said frequencies. It's not impossible but I doubt it's the case. Same goes for the ZSA's single BA for treble and midrange versus the ZS6's separate BA's for said frequencies.

I'm expecting the ZSA to be a great addition to my KZ collection but until there is enough feedback to make an informed decision it's best to keep definitive statements to nought.

Regarding the ZSA being short-lived, I wouldn't give this much thought either since KZ made it clear that they spared no expense to give us well crafted CNC Aluminum housing.

HTB18.AXi5OYBuNjSsD4q6zSkFXaz.jpg_640x640q90-2.jpg


Return on investment dictates that the ZSA should be with us for a while provided KZ continues that which has become synonymous with their brand, exceptional price-to-performance ratio.

Think about it:
CNC aluminum housing, detachable cables and hopefully great tuning

.....ALL FOR $22!

HTB1LhjIi2iSBuNkSnhJq6zDcpXar.jpg_640x640q90-1.jpg


I'd like to see KZ continue on this path of high quality metal housing. It's one of the factors that set them apart from every other wannabe in the growing sea of budget oriented Chi-Fi brands. KZ actually needs this edge to stay in the forefront. The only reason they haven't been dethroned as "budget king" is because others brands tend to have a one-hit-wonder or two.
